Adjective [English]

IPA: /ˈblaʊzi/ Forms: blowsier [comparative], blowsiest [superlative]
Rhymes: -aʊzi Etymology: blowse + -y Etymology templates: {{suffix|en|blowse|y}} blowse + -y Head templates: {{en-adj|er}} blowsy (comparative blowsier, superlative blowsiest)
  1. Having a reddish, coarse complexion, especially with a pudgy face. Translations (Having a reddish, coarse complexion): зачервен (začerven) (Bulgarian), червендалест (červendalest) (Bulgarian)
    Sense id: en-blowsy-en-adj-Rnm3xyPc Categories (other): English entries with incorrect language header, English terms suffixed with -y Disambiguation of English entries with incorrect language header: 84 8 8 Disambiguation of English terms suffixed with -y: 68 13 20 Disambiguation of 'Having a reddish, coarse complexion': 93 3 5
  2. (chiefly of a woman's hair or dress) Slovenly or unkempt, in the manner of a beggar or slattern. Translations (Slovenly or unkept): рошав (rošav) (Bulgarian), раздърпан (razdǎrpan) (Bulgarian)
    Sense id: en-blowsy-en-adj-KiVO0Qnt Disambiguation of 'Slovenly or unkept': 9 87 3
  3. Unrefined, countrified.
    Sense id: en-blowsy-en-adj-CUtxDTyv
The following are not (yet) sense-disambiguated
Synonyms: blousy, blouzy, blowsey, blowzy
